What Counts as an Instant Bank Transfer Casino in 2026?
An instant bank transfer casino is simply an online casino that lets you move money from your bank account to your casino balance without a card or e-wallet in between. In 2026, that usually means one of three things.
First, Open Banking payments. You authorise a bank-to-bank transfer through an app like Trustly or a Pay by Bank option. The casino gets confirmation in seconds, and your balance updates almost immediately. This is the closest thing to “instant” you’ll find.
Second, direct bank transfer via online banking. You log into your bank separately, send a payment, and then upload a reference or wait for the casino to match it. Not instant. Clunky. Still common at older sites.
Third, bank wire transfer. This is the slow, expensive cousin. Some casinos still list it as a deposit method, but it’s not instant and often comes with fees. If a casino only offers this, walk away.
Most UK-facing casinos now use Open Banking rails, which is why the term “instant bank transfer casino” has moved from rare to standard. But the catch is that only deposits are instant. Withdrawals still go through fraud checks, internal review, and batch processing. We’ll come back to that.
How Instant Bank Transfer Actually Works for Casino Payments
Let’s be precise about the mechanics. When you choose an instant bank transfer deposit, you’re not giving the casino your bank login. You’re redirected to a payment provider or your bank’s secure app, where you approve a single payment. The casino receives a token that says “paid” and credits your account.
That’s it. No card number, no CVV, no stored card details. For security-conscious players, this is the main selling point.
Deposits: Open Banking vs Traditional Bank Transfer
Open Banking deposits are fast because the payment request is pre-filled. You select your bank, confirm with your usual banking app, and the funds move in real time. Some payment providers use faster payments, which means the money lands within seconds or minutes. That’s why casinos can say “instant” without lying.
Traditional bank transfer deposits, where you manually enter sort code and account number, are slower. You might need to wait for the casino’s finance team to reconcile the payment. On a good day, that’s a few hours. On a bad day, it’s a support ticket.
For 2026, the standard at reputable UK casinos is Open Banking via Trustly, Nuapay, or a bank’s own Pay by Bank integration. If a site still asks you to write down reference numbers, it’s not really an instant bank transfer casino.
Withdrawals: Why Your Bank Transfer Is Not Always Instant
Here’s the part most guides gloss over. A casino might process your withdrawal request within 24 hours, but the money then goes through a bank transfer that can take one to three working days. Some operators batch withdrawals once a day. Others require a first-time verification hold.
The delay is not the bank’s fault. It’s the casino’s internal risk controls. They check for bonus abuse, money laundering flags, and payment method consistency. That’s legitimate. But it means “instant bank transfer casino” is a deposit claim, not a withdrawal promise.
Our advice: look at the withdrawal policy before you deposit. The best operators in our table below publish clear timeframes and don’t sit on your money.

Is Instant Bank Transfer Legal and Safe in the UK?
Yes, as long as the casino holds a UK Gambling Commission (UKGC) licence. Every operator in our table is licensed by the UKGC, which means they must segregate player funds, follow anti-money laundering rules, and offer self-exclusion tools via GamStop.
Bank transfers themselves are safe because you never share your bank login with the casino. Open Banking uses your bank’s own secure authentication. The casino only sees that the payment was approved, not your account balance or transaction history.
One caveat: not all bank transfer casinos are legal for UK players. Offshore sites may accept UK players without a UKGC licence, and while bank transfers might work, you have no recourse if something goes wrong. Stick to UKGC-licensed operators. It’s not a moral stance—it’s practical risk management.
Fees, Limits and Processing Times: The Real Numbers
Most UK casinos do not charge fees for bank transfer deposits. Some payment providers may impose a small fee, but that’s rare for Open Banking. Withdrawals are usually free, but some casinos cap the number of free withdrawals per month before adding a fee.
Minimum deposit amounts vary, but £10 is typical. Maximum limits depend on your bank and the casino’s risk policy. High rollers may need to go through enhanced verification, which slows things down.
Processing times are where the “instant” fantasy dies. Deposits: instant. Withdrawals: one to three working days after the casino approves them. The casino approval step is the wildcard. Some approve within hours, others take 48 hours. Then the bank transfer itself takes up to two working days.
This table summarises the realistic differences between payment methods.
| Method | Deposit Speed | Withdrawal Speed | Typical Fees | Security |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Instant bank transfer | Seconds to minutes | 1–3 working days | None | High (bank authentication) |
| Debit card | Instant | 1–5 working days | None | High |
| E-wallet | Instant | 0–24 hours | Often free | High |
| Bank wire | 1–3 days | 3–7 working days | Often high | High but slow |
E-wallets are faster for withdrawals, but not everyone wants another account. Bank transfer is the middle path: instant in, slower out.
Instant Bank Transfer Casino Bonuses and Why They Are Not “Free Money”
Every casino bonus has strings attached. A welcome bonus might sound generous, but wagering requirements mean you’ll need to bet the bonus amount many times before any winnings can be withdrawn. If a casino offers “free spins” or a “gift”, remember that the house always has an edge.
The operators in our table all have bonuses, but we deliberately did not list numeric amounts. Numbers change weekly, and chasing the biggest number is a fool’s game. What matters is the wagering requirement, game contribution, and time limit.
A “free” bonus is not free. It’s a marketing cost built into the operator’s margin. You’re paying for it somewhere, usually through worse odds or stricter withdrawal conditions. Treat any bonus as a loan with conditions, not a gift.

Responsible Gambling and the Bank Transfer Reality
One advantage of bank transfer is that it forces you to check your bank balance before depositing. There’s no one-click deposit with saved card details. That small friction can help with impulse control. But it’s not a substitute for deposit limits.
Every UKGC-licensed casino must offer deposit limits, session reminders, and self-exclusion via GamStop. Use them. If you ever feel that bank transfers make it too easy to move money, set a limit through your bank as well. Banks have gambling blocks now—turn them on if needed.
Gambling is not a way to make money. The house edge is real, and no strategy changes that. Treat any loss as the cost of entertainment, not an investment gone wrong.
